The EPA suggests that homeowners with radon amounts of 2.0 pCi/L or bigger take into consideration getting action to decreased indoor radon concentrations. The EPA also suggests that homes with radon amounts of 4.0 pCi/L or bigger needs to be fixed or mitigated for radon.
